In 2020-2021, 3,225 people earned their degree in digital arts, making the major the 233rd most popular in the United States.

Across Kentucky, there were 51 digital arts gra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the bachelor’s degree level specifically, there were 51 digital arts graduates with average earnings and debt of $35,941 and $26,734 respectively.

This year’s “Schools for a Bachelor’s Highly Focused on Art & Technology Major in Kentucky” ranking looked at 2 colleges that offer degrees in a bachelor’s in digital arts. The colleges and universities that top this list are recognized because their digital arts program is one of the largest majors offered at the school.

University of Kentucky
Lexington, Kentucky

Out of the 2 schools in the Schools for a Bachelor’s Highly Focused on Art & Technology Major in Kentucky that were part of this year’s ranking, University of Kentucky landed the #1 spot on the list. Lexington, Kentucky is the setting for this large institution of higher learning. The public school handed out bachelors’s art and technology degrees to 45 students in 2020-2021.

Students who start out at the school are likely to stick around. The freshman retention rate is 86%. The school has an impressive undergrad student loan default rate. It’s only 4.3%, which is much lower than the national rate of 10.1%.
